The Dark Side: When Licence to Squirrel Becomes a Problem
While Licence to Squirrel can be an entertaining and potentially lucrative game, its risks should not be underestimated. Players who become too engrossed in the game may experience financial difficulties, relationship strain, or even mental health issues.
It’s essential for players to recognize the warning signs of problem gaming:
- Spending more time and money than intended
- Feeling anxious or guilty about playing
- Neglecting responsibilities due to gaming habits
- Continuing to play despite negative consequences
If you find yourself exhibiting any of these behaviors, it may be time to take a step back and reassess your relationship with Licence to Squirrel.
